About Duty Rates: Rates are divided into Column 1 and Column 2. Column 1 is subdivided into General (normal trade relations rates for all countries not eligible for special programs) and Special (preferential rates for countries with free trade agreements or preference programs). Column 2 rates apply to products from Cuba, North Korea, Belarus, and Russia. When no special rate exists for a classification, General rates apply.

Overview

This HTS classification, 6211.33.90.42, specifically covers other garments for men or boys, constructed from man-made fibers, which are not shirts under heading 6205. The defining characteristic of this category is its intended use in specific, controlled environments. These garments are designed for application in hospitals, clinics, laboratories, or other areas where contamination control is paramount. This includes items like specialized smocks, coveralls, or gowns that provide a barrier against potential contaminants.

This classification is distinct from its sibling category, 6211.33.90.44 ("Other"), which would encompass similar man-made fiber garments for men or boys that do not have the specific designated use in medical, scientific, or contaminated environments. While both fall under "Other garments, men's or boys': Of man-made fibers: Other: Shirts excluded from heading 6205," the crucial differentiator here is the explicit functional purpose related to contamination control.

As this is a leaf node, there are no further subcategories. Therefore, classification within 6211.33.90.42 hinges directly on meeting the criteria of being a man-made fiber garment for men or boys, excluded from heading 6205, and designed for use in hospitals, clinics, laboratories, or contaminated areas. Practical examples might include disposable lab coats made of non-woven synthetic materials, or reusable coveralls intended for use in cleanroom environments.
